首页培训课程区SQLServer2005数据还原全攻略5步恢复指南常见问题解决附工具推荐

SQLServer2005数据还原全攻略5步恢复指南常见问题解决附工具推荐

分类培训课程区时间2026-04-11 09:32:30发布恢复培训君浏览652
摘要:✨SQL Server 2005数据还原全攻略:5步恢复指南+常见问题解决(附工具推荐)🔧一、为什么需要SQL Server 2005数据恢复?💡数据丢失的5大常见场景:1️⃣ 硬盘损坏/系统崩溃2️⃣ 误删或误改数据库文件3️⃣ SQL服务意外终止4️⃣ 备份文件损坏5️⃣ 病毒攻击导致数据损坏📌本文价值:✔️完整覆盖2005版本特性✔️提供官方+第三方解决方案✔️包含预防性操作指南二、数据恢复...

✨SQL Server 2005数据还原全攻略:5步恢复指南+常见问题解决(附工具推荐)🔧

一、为什么需要SQL Server 2005数据恢复?

💡数据丢失的5大常见场景:

1️⃣ 硬盘损坏/系统崩溃

2️⃣ 误删或误改数据库文件

3️⃣ SQL服务意外终止

4️⃣ 备份文件损坏

5️⃣ 病毒攻击导致数据损坏

📌本文价值:

✔️完整覆盖2005版本特性

✔️提供官方+第三方解决方案

✔️包含预防性操作指南

二、数据恢复基础准备(必看清单)

🔧必备工具准备:

1️⃣ Microsoft SQL Server 2005安装包(含SP4)

2️⃣ SQL Server Management Studio (SSMS) 2005版

3️⃣ 数据库备份文件(BAK/BAK2)

4️⃣ 日志文件(*.ldf)

5️⃣ 第三方工具推荐:R-Studio/SQLyog

⚠️注意事项:

✅关闭所有占用数据库的服务

✅确保恢复环境硬件配置≥原系统

✅准备至少3倍容量的临时存储空间

三、官方恢复流程5步走(附截图)

步骤1:检查数据库状态

👉打开SSMS 2005

👉连接目标服务器

👉右键数据库→属性→恢复

👉选择"从备份恢复"

步骤2:选择恢复点

📅默认恢复到最新备份时间

⏳手动调整恢复时间:

①右键备份文件→属性→时间戳

②输入具体恢复时间

步骤3:验证备份有效性

🔧执行DBCC CHECKDB命令:

```sql

DBCC CHECKDB ('YourDatabaseName') WITH NOREPAIR, NOREPLACE,继续

```

✅成功返回"DBCC execution completed without errors"

步骤4:恢复操作执行

🔄右键备份文件→恢复

👉选择恢复目标

👉设置恢复日志选项

👉点击"继续"开始恢复

步骤5:完整性检查

📊执行DBCC CHECKCATALOG命令

📊检查表结构完整性

📊确认所有事务日志已应用

四、进阶恢复方案(高阶技巧)

🔧日志恢复全流程:

1️⃣ 检查日志链完整性:

```sql

SELECT * FROM sys.dbo.logfile

```

2️⃣ 重建日志链:

```sql

DBCC LOG scan (YourDatabaseName)

```

3️⃣ 执行事务恢复:

```sql

RESTORE LOG YourDatabaseName

WITH NOREPLACE, STOP AT '-01-01 14:00:00'

```

🛠️第三方工具使用指南:

1️⃣ R-Studio恢复:

①选择MSSQL数据库文件

②点击"开放"按钮

③选择备份文件进行重建

④导出MDF/LDF文件

2️⃣ SQLyog恢复:

①导入BAK文件

②选择恢复模式

③设置事务隔离级别

④点击"执行恢复"

五、常见问题解决方案(Q&A)

Q1:恢复后数据丢失怎么办?

👉检查恢复点是否正确

👉确认备份文件完整性

👉尝试使用DBCC REPAIR命令

Q2:遇到"无法打开文件"错误?

🔧解决方案:

①检查MDF/LDF文件路径

②确认文件未被其他程序占用

③修复磁盘错误(chkdsk /f)

Q3:恢复后事务不完整?

🛠️处理步骤:

①检查事务日志链

②重建日志备份

③执行事务回滚

六、数据防丢终极指南

🔒3-2-1备份原则:

3份拷贝 → 2种介质 → 1份异地

📅自动备份设置:

1️⃣ 创建计划任务:

①任务类型→启动程序

②执行文件→cmd.exe

③命令→net start SQLServer2005 + "YourDatabaseName"

2️⃣ 设置备份策略:

🌙每日全备+每周差异备

🌙每月完整备份+事务日志

💡最佳实践:

✔️每次更新后立即备份数据库

✔️备份文件加密存储(AES-256)

✔️定期演练恢复流程

七、专业服务推荐

🏥数据恢复服务商TOP3:

1️⃣ 赛虎数据恢复(服务费2000-5000元)

2️⃣ 网易数读(24小时响应)

3️⃣ 硅基存储(支持企业级恢复)

💰费用参考:

🔧简单恢复:500-1000元

🔧复杂恢复:2000-8000元

🔧企业级恢复:5000元起

八、未来趋势与升级建议

🚀SQL Server 2005升级路线:

1️⃣ 2005→2008R2(推荐)

2️⃣ 2008R2→

3️⃣ →+(当前最新)

📈升级成本预估:

💰硬件升级:30-50%

💰迁移费用:5-10万/次

💰培训成本:2-5万/团队

🔧升级必做清单:

2️⃣ 存储过程重构

3️⃣ 性能调优参数设置

4️⃣ 安全策略更新

🌟🌟

掌握SQL Server 2005数据恢复技术,不仅能挽救企业级数据资产,更能提升IT团队专业形象。建议收藏本文并转发给技术团队,定期演练恢复流程,将数据安全纳入日常运维重点。

SQL Server 2005数据还原

SQL2005恢复步骤

数据库恢复官方指南

SQL Server日志恢复

SQL Server 2005备份恢复

图片 ✨SQLServer2005数据还原全攻略:5步恢复指南+常见问题解决(附工具推荐)🔧

QQ媒体数据删除后如何恢复3步教你轻松找回重要文件附详细教程 优盘数据恢复教程彻底删除文件如何找回手把手教你从优盘恢复误删照片文档视频